Main Features Compared

Gusto specializes in payroll processing, providing businesses with an efficient and comprehensive solution for managing employee compensation, tax filings, and compliance issues. It streamlines payroll activities, ensuring timely payments and reducing the administrative burden for HR teams.

On the other hand, Gloat excels as a talent marketplace, offering companies a platform to match internal talent with available roles and projects. This feature promotes employee engagement and retention, allowing organizations to harness their existing human resources effectively. Gloat’s unique marketplace provides valuable insights into employee skills, enabling more strategic workforce planning.
